Coverage

This release provides information on the levels of overall, authorised and unauthorised absence in:

  • state-funded primary schools
  • state-funded secondary schools
  • special schools

It includes:

  • reasons for absence
  • absence by pupil characteristic
  • rates of persistent and severe absence
  • separate absence information for state-funded alternative provision (including pupil referral units, alternative provision academies and free schools)

The information is based on pupil level absence data collected via the school census.

Rounding and Suppression

This dataset has not had suppression applied. Rates are presented to one decimal place in the report but are unrounded in the underlying data files

Conventions

The following convention is used throughout the underlying data. 

‘x’  Not available.

‘z’  Not applicable
